About Tanya Garg
Tanya Garg is a scholar working on Building and Construction, Health Information Management and Signal Processing, having authored 12 papers that have together received 99 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traffic Prediction and Management Techniques (3 papers), Network Security and Intrusion Detection (3 papers) and Traffic control and management (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Signal Processing (23 citations), Computer Networks and Communications (44 citations) and Artificial Intelligence (34 citations). Tanya Garg has collaborated with scholars based in India, United Kingdom and United Arab Emirates. Frequent co-authors include Surinder Singh Khurana, Yogesh Kumar, G. K. Rajanikant, Mohammad S. Obaidat, Prashant Singh Rana, Shashank Gupta, Xiaochun Cheng, Manish Kumar and Chandramohan Dhasarathan. Their work appears in journals such as CNS & Neurological Disorders - Drug Targets, Cluster Computing and SN Computer Science.
